The Town of Hempstead has been held in contempt of the court by a state judge for failing to provide FOILed emails containing information about a Suffolk County lawsuit charging that a driver was improperly ticketed by school bus cameras.
According to court documents, the town had previously entered into an agreement to provide roughly 3,000 emails to Brooklyn-based law firm Aron Law PLLC, which had sued on behalf of its clients to obtain all emails in the town’s servers that contain the word “croce.”
